Allen started playing football at his local club Chester City.
He made a total of 282 appearances and scored 50 goals while playing for RoPS, TPS, MYPA and TPV.
[3] In November 2009 Allen signed a two-year contract with RoPS, then playing in the second highest division of Finnish football system.
[4] After only one season with RoPS they gained promotion to Veikkausliiga after being crowned the champions of Ykkönen.
[5] Allen joined Swedish team Oskarshamns AIK in December 2018, where he lasted as headcoach until April 2020.
